在数字产品的设计中,按钮交互是用户与界面之间沟通的重要桥梁。一个优秀的按钮设计不仅能提升用户体验,还能有效引导用户完成操作。本文将深入探讨按钮交互的设计原则、用户心理以及背后的技术细节,帮助读者更好地理解用户点击背后的秘密。
一、按钮交互设计原则
1. 明确性
按钮的文字、图标和颜色应清晰传达其功能。避免使用模糊或歧义的词汇,如“点击这里”、“下一步”等,应具体说明按钮的功能,如“登录”、“注册”、“添加到购物车”等。
2. 一致性
按钮的设计风格应与整体界面保持一致,包括颜色、形状、大小和字体等。一致性有助于用户快速识别和理解按钮的功能。
3. 可访问性
确保按钮对所有用户都易于访问,包括色盲用户、视障用户等。例如,为按钮提供足够的对比度,使用可访问的字体大小和颜色。
4. 交互反馈
按钮在用户点击后应有明显的交互反馈,如颜色变化、动画效果等,以增强用户的操作体验。
二、用户心理分析
1. 期望效应
用户在点击按钮前,会根据按钮的视觉元素和文字描述产生一定的期望。设计者应确保按钮的功能与用户的期望相符,避免产生误导。
2. 习惯性操作
用户在使用过程中会形成一定的操作习惯。设计者应充分考虑用户的习惯,避免过于复杂的操作流程。
3. 疲劳效应
长时间使用同一产品可能导致用户产生疲劳。设计者可通过优化按钮布局、颜色搭配等方式,减轻用户的视觉疲劳。
三、技术细节
1. 响应式设计
随着移动设备的普及,响应式设计变得尤为重要。按钮应适应不同屏幕尺寸和分辨率,保证用户体验。
2. 动画效果
适当的动画效果可以提升用户的操作体验,但需注意动画的加载时间和流畅性。
3. 性能优化
按钮的加载速度和响应速度直接影响用户体验。设计者应优化按钮的代码,确保其性能。
四、案例分析
以下是一个按钮交互设计的案例:
<button id="loginBtn" class="btn btn-primary">登录</button>
.btn {
padding: 10px 20px;
border: none;
border-radius: 5px;
color: white;
font-size: 16px;
cursor: pointer;
}
.btn-primary {
background-color: #007bff;
}
#loginBtn:hover {
background-color: #0056b3;
}
在这个例子中,按钮使用了Bootstrap框架的样式,具有明确的文字描述、响应式设计和简单的动画效果。
五、总结
掌握按钮交互的设计原则、用户心理和技术细节,有助于提升数字产品的用户体验。在设计按钮交互时,应充分考虑用户的需求和习惯,确保按钮的功能、视觉和交互设计相辅相成。
